Prolific and Toloka both sit at the accessible, lower-barrier end of the remote gig work market, but they come from completely different worlds. Prolific is a UK-based academic research platform connecting participants with university and industry researchers for surveys and experiments. Toloka is Yandex's AI data annotation platform, offering microtasks for global workers contributing to AI training pipelines.
These platforms attract similar workers — those looking for accessible remote income without specialized technical skills — but the work experience, pay structure, and geographic availability differ significantly.

Prolific enforces a minimum payment of £9/hr (approximately $11/hr) for all studies, and effective rates typically range from $6–18/hr depending on study length and researcher budget. Payments are processed within 24–48 hours of study completion via PayPal or Circle — among the fastest payment cycles in the gig work market. Academic compliance rules give Prolific participants more protection than general annotation workers.
Toloka pays $5–20/hr on a per-task microtask model, with effective hourly rates depending heavily on task speed, accuracy, and availability. Rates vary significantly by country — workers in Eastern Europe and Central Asia often see more competitive rates relative to cost of living than Western European or US workers. Payments are weekly to monthly depending on withdrawal method and country.
Prolific's minimum rate guarantee is a meaningful protection that Toloka doesn't offer — on Toloka, slow task periods can push effective hourly rates very low. For workers in the UK and Western Europe, Prolific offers better hourly outcomes. For workers in Eastern Europe and Central Asia, Toloka may be more competitive given stronger regional task availability.
Prolific offers research participation exclusively: surveys, psychological experiments, behavioral studies, cognitive tasks, UX research, and academic decision-making tasks. Every study is different, which many workers find engaging. Work is passive and requires no technical skill development — you're a participant, not a labeler.
Toloka offers a very wide range of microtasks: image and object classification, text categorization, form filling, product review, search relevance, audio annotation, and more. The breadth of task types is Toloka's biggest advantage — workers with different skills and interests can find relevant work. Tasks are repetitive by nature but the variety across task categories is wide.
Bottom Line
Prolific is the better choice for workers in the UK, US, and Western Europe who want protected hourly minimums and fast payments. Toloka is the stronger option in Eastern Europe and Central Asia, and for workers who want the widest possible variety of task types.
